TPWallet诞生意味着“钱包即服务”从功能堆叠走向体系化工程:一方面面向普通用户提供可用、易用、安全的支付体验,另一方面面向开发者与生态伙伴提供可扩展的技术栈。本文将从防SQL注入、未来科技创新、行业态势、高效能技术应用、区块链技术与支付设置六个维度进行综合分析,解释TPWallet为何在同质化竞争中更强调工程安全与体验闭环。
一、防SQL注入:让“安全”成为默认能力
在涉及登录、转账记录、订单状态、费率查询、黑名单/白名单管理等业务时,任何拼接式查询都可能引发SQL注入风险。TPWallet的关键应对思路应包括:
1)使用参数化查询与预编译语句。所有来自用户输入(如地址、memo、交易哈希、备注、手机号/邮箱、订单号)的字段不得直接拼接进SQL;统一走参数绑定。
2)建立输入校验与语义约束。地址格式、哈希长度、链ID范围、金额精度、支付凭证字段等,必须在进入数据库前完成格式与范围校验,避免“看似正常但携带恶意片段”的输入。
3)最小权限数据库账号。钱包系统不应使用高权限账号连库;读写拆分、表级权限控制、必要时分库分权限,降低注入后横向影响。
4)安全日志与告警联动。对异常输入模式(如高频失败、可疑字符组合、异常延迟)进行审计;对关键接口启用风控与告警。
5)统一ORM/数据访问层规范。通过代码规范与审计工具强制执行“禁止字符串拼接SQL”,并在CI/CD中进行静态扫描。
当防SQL注入被当作“默认能力”嵌入研发流程,TPWallet才能在支付高并发场景中保持稳定与可审计性。
二、未来科技创新:从“能用”到“更懂你”的智能支付
未来钱包的竞争不再只是“支持哪些链/资产”,而是“能否把复杂性隐藏,并在安全前提下提升效率”。TPWallet的创新方向可以体现在:
1)意图驱动(Intent-based)支付。用户表达“我要买某资产/还某笔账/转账给某联系人”,系统自动完成路由选择、费用估算、滑点控制与链上/链下交互。
2)更精细的风险与隐私计算。通过链上证据与行为特征结合,实现交易风险分级、设备可信度判断、可疑地址提示等。
3)更友好的跨链体验。对用户而言,“跨链”应被抽象为一键完成的支付流程;对底层而言,则要优化跨链消息传递、资产托管与确认策略。
4)智能合约交互助手。对常见操作提供安全提示(例如Gas上限建议、权限风险提醒、授权范围提示),减少“误授权、误签名”。
这些创新的共同点是:把复杂技术转化为稳定、可验证、可追责的用户体验。
三、行业态势:钱包正在成为支付入口与生态枢纽
当前行业呈现三种趋势:
1)用户侧:支付场景从单一转账扩展到“支付+理财+手续费管理+资产对账”。钱包不再是冷存储工具,而是日常金融入口。
2)生态侧:交易所、DApp、商户、支付服务商希望通过钱包完成更顺畅的触达与回款闭环,钱包因此承担了“身份、路由与结算”的中间层角色。
3)监管与合规侧:KYC/KYB、反洗钱(AML)与交易审查成为常态。钱包若要长期增长,需要在合规能力、风控能力与可审计性上持续投入。
TPWallet的价值,在于将安全与支付设置体系化:让用户能清楚看到授权、费率、链路与确认状态,同时让系统能在高压与高风险环境中保持稳定。
四、高效能技术应用:让交易更快、更省、更稳
钱包与支付系统面对的是“高并发 + 链上不可预期 + 多链异构”。高效能技术应用应覆盖:
1)缓存与读优化。交易列表、余额快照、费率/汇率、路由策略等高频读请求应缓存;同时设置合理的失效策略与一致性策略。
2)异步化与任务编排。链上确认、索引同步、通知推送、风控审查等不应阻塞主请求;用队列与任务编排提升吞吐。
3)并行请求与熔断降级。面对多RPC/多节点环境,采用并行查询、健康检查、失败重试与熔断机制,保障故障时的可用性。
4)索引与检索优化。交易哈希、订单号、地址聚合等查询需要合适的索引设计,并对分页、排序字段进行严格约束。
5)安全与性能协同。风控规则、签名校验、权限检查等应在安全边界内高效执行,避免“安全越强越慢”的误区。
这些做法最终目标是:提升确认速度、降低失败率、让用户在支付设置中获得更确定的状态反馈。
五、区块链技术:把“可验证”落到工程细节
TPWallet的核心离不开区块链技术栈,至少包括:
1)账户与签名体系。私钥安全存储(如安全模块/加密托管/本地加密)、签名流程的正确性校验、重放保护与nonce管理。
2)跨链与路由。通过桥接/中继机制或聚合路由选择实现跨链转移,同时处理不同链的确认最终性、失败补偿与资产可追踪。
3)链上数据索引与状态机。钱包需要把链上事件映射到本地状态(如订单创建、签名、广播、确认、失败、退款等),形成可追踪的状态机。
4)智能合约交互与安全提示。合约调用前进行参数校验、权限范围审查、Gas估算与异常预判。

5)隐私与合规的平衡。对敏感信息采用脱敏存储与最小化采集;同时保留审计所需的关键证据链。
区块链让交易“可验证”,而工程化的状态机与安全边界让验证“可用、可追责”。
六、支付设置:让用户能控、系统能稳
支付设置是TPWallet体验闭环的关键。合理的支付设置不仅提升转化率,也降低操作错误与资产风险。建议的设置体系包括:
1)链与网络选择。默认网络、自动切换规则、Gas策略(如保守/标准/快速)可被用户理解并选择。
2)收款与联系人管理。支持地址簿、别名、账单记忆与模板化备注;并对地址校验、格式提示提供即时反馈。

3)费率与额度管理。让用户清楚看到交易费、服务费(如适用)、以及最大授权额度;可提供“授权上限/一次性授权”选项。
4)安全选项。启用设备绑定、二次确认、风控提示阈值(如大额/陌生地址)、以及异常交易阻止策略。
5)通知与对账。交易状态通知(广播/确认/失败/退款)、对账单导出、会计友好的流水字段,减少后续纠纷。
6)退款与撤销策略。明确哪些操作可撤销、哪些不可逆;对于失败交易提供自动重试或补偿路径,并在界面中给出透明解释。
当支付设置做到“可控 + 可解释 + 可审计”,用户信任会显著提升。
结语:TPWallet的关键不只是功能,而是安全与效率的统一
TPWallet诞生的意义在于:把防SQL注入等安全实践前置,把未来智能支付与意图驱动落到体验层,把高效能工程支撑多链支付的真实需求,并以区块链技术实现可验证交易。最终,支付设置将用户的每一次关键选择透明化,让系统既能快速响应,也能在异常情况下给出可靠处理。面向未来,真正的竞争优势将来自“系统性工程能力”——安全、性能、可扩展、可合规,缺一不可。
评论
Nova酱
把SQL注入防护写进钱包工程里很关键,安全默认才配得上支付入口的地位。
KiraWang
区块链可验证+状态机工程化这段很打动人,能落到“订单可追踪”就更实用。
阿柚不吃鱼
支付设置讲得具体:Gas策略、授权上限、通知对账都有了,像是真正在做产品。
Mason_7
高效能那几条(缓存/异步/熔断)结合多链场景很合理,能降低链上不确定性带来的失败率。
LunaR
未来意图驱动的方向对用户友好,希望TPWallet能在风险提示上更细致。
晨雾Fox
合规和可审计性提到点上了,钱包要长期增长靠的就是这套体系。